Key Applications in Synthesis

Tosyl isocyanate is prominent in organic synthesis, where it facilitates tosylation reactions and isocyanate functionalization. This compound is indispensable in the production of sulfonylureas for pharmaceuticals and in the formulation of agrochemicals. Its high reactivity and selectivity make it a preferred reagent for laboratories and industrial chemists.


Safety and Handling Protocols

As a toxic and corrosive substance, Tosyl isocyanate should always be handled in a well-ventilated area using protective equipment. It decomposes with moisture and releases toxic fumes, so avoid exposure to water and incompatible substances. Store in a tightly sealed container in a cool, dry location and adhere to recommended safety phrases and transport conditions.

FAQs of Tosyl isocyanate:


Q: How should Tosyl isocyanate be safely handled and stored?

A: Tosyl isocyanate should be handled with appropriate protective gear (gloves, goggles, and face shield) in a well-ventilated area. Store it in a tightly sealed container, preferably HDPE drums, in a cool, dry place away from moisture, heat, and incompatible chemicals like water, alcohols, or amines.

Q: What is the main usage of Tosyl isocyanate in industry?

A: Tosyl isocyanate is extensively used as a reagent in organic synthesis, particularly for tosylation reactions, isocyanate functionalization, and the synthesis of sulfonylureas found in pharmaceuticals and agrochemicals.

Q: When should extra precautions be taken during the handling process?

A: Extra precautions are essential when transferring, opening, or weighing the product, as exposure to air and moisture can cause decomposition and the release of toxic, corrosive fumes. Use personal protective equipment and implement spill control measures during all handling steps.

Q: Where is Tosyl isocyanate typically applied or utilized?

A: Tosyl isocyanate is utilized in chemical laboratories and research industries, especially in pharmaceutical synthesis, agrochemical manufacturing, and other organic chemical productions requiring tosylation or isocyanate groups.

Q: What are the benefits of using Tosyl isocyanate in chemical synthesis?

A: Its high reactivity and selectivity allow for efficient tosylation and incorporation of isocyanate groups, leading to streamlined synthesis of complex molecules in both research and industrial applications.

Q: How is Tosyl isocyanate transported safely?

A: Tosyl isocyanate should be transported as a toxic material (UN 2811, Hazard Class 6.1) in properly labeled, sealed containers, and handled by trained personnel to prevent any accidental release or exposure.
